Why the traditional approach no longer applies

For many years, test automation has focused on the graphical user interface (GUI) used to interface between a human being and the computer. In integration and SOA projects, there is rarely a GUI interface, negating the use of a traditional GUI test automation tool.

Instead, the system is expecting a request from another computer system. To automate the testing, you need to simulate this other computer system quickly, easily and without coding. Similarly, there is also a lot going on behind the scenes to implement successful processing of the request. GUI test automation can miss these vital clues. Finally, the quantity of dependencies in these new SOA and integration projects can be staggering, rendering traditional testing techniques useless. Users need a way to simulate the other systems that this system depends upon.
